Well Water Treatment NJ
If your water supply is a private well, you are personally responsible for testing and treating the water to avoid health risks. Your major concerns should be microbial pathogens (bacteria, virus and parasites) in the water supply. This is especially important if your well is near a septic tank, or an area subject to animal wastes or nitrates
